Ingredients
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 6 oz each)
- 1 block of feta cheese, crumbled
- 1/2 cup of extra virgin olive oil
- 1/4 cup of red wine vinegar
- 2 cloves of gar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on of dried oregano
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
Instructions
- Step 1: Preparation –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Rinse the chicken breasts and pat them dry with a paper towel. Season with salt, pepper, and a sprinkle of oregano.
- Step 2: Baking the Chicken – Place the chicken breasts on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and drizzle with a little olive oil. Bake in the preheated oven for about 20-25 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C).
- Step 3: Preparing the Feta and Vinaigrette – While the chicken is baking, prepare the crispy feta. Place the crumbled feta on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and bake in the oven for about 5-7 minutes, or until it’s lightly browned and crispy. For the vinaigrette, whisk together the olive oil, red wine vinegar, minced garlic, salt, and pepper in a small bowl.
- Step 4: Final Touches – Once the chicken is done, let it rest for a few minutes before slicing. Drizzle the vinaigrette over the sliced chicken, top with crispy feta, and garnish with chopped parsley. Serve immediately and enjoy!
Handy Tips
- For an extra crispy feta, you can broil it for an additional minute, keeping a close eye to prevent burning.
- Don’t overcrowd the baking sheet with the chicken to ensure even cooking.
- Let the chicken rest before slicing to retain its juices and tenderness.
Heat Control
The key to perfectly baked chicken is maintaining the right oven temperature and not overcooking it. Ensure your oven is at 400°F (200°C) and use a thermometer to check the internal temperature of the chicken, which should be 165°F (74°C) when it’s fully cooked. For the feta, a short baking time at the same temperature is sufficient to achieve crispiness without burning.

Storage Tips
- Leftover chicken can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at gently in the oven or microwave until warmed through.
- The vinaigrette can be made ahead and stored in the fridge for up to a week. Give it a good stir before using.
- Crispy feta is best consumed immediately, but you can store it in an airtight container at room temperature for a day. Refresh its crispiness by baking it in the oven for a few minutes.

Troubleshooting
- If the chicken is dry, it may have been overcooked. Adjust the baking time and temperature as needed.
- If the feta doesn’t crisp up, try broiling it for a shorter time or checking if the oven temperature is accurate.
- If the vinaigrette is too sharp, balance it out with a bit more olive oil or a pinch of sugar.
